FBT aren’t much of a climber. They spend most their time in the water or at its edge. That being said, the water portion is too small and you’re wasting all that vertical space.
You could go with a Reed Frogs but they’re nocturnal and not too active. If you do , you’ll want more leafy plants for them.

I could see this being used to house a single Yellow Spotted Climbing Toad or a few Dart Frogs. FBTs are not good climbers and can injure themselves trying. They appreciate a more horizontal setup.
